BackgroundApamistamab is a monoclonal antibody developed for targeted radiotherapy in hematologic malignancies. It is commonly used in radioimmunotherapy as a carrier for radioactive isotopes, facilitating the targeted destruction of malignant cells while minimizing damage to healthy tissues. It has been studied primarily in the context of conditioning regimens for hematopoietic stem cell transplantation, particularly in treating relapsed or refractory leukemias and lymphomas.
